Search a number
-
+
758578990 = 251319319907
BaseRepresentation
bin101101001101101…
…111111100101110
31221212101210202011
4231031233330232
53023144011430
6203134551434
724540546361
oct5515577456
91855353664
10758578990
1135a21a694
1219206857a
13c120c610
1472a660d8
15468e422a
hex2d36ff2e

758578990 has 64 divisors (see below), whose sum is σ = 1597962240. Its totient is φ = 256763520.

The previous prime is 758578987. The next prime is 758578993. The reversal of 758578990 is 99875857.

It is an interprime number because it is at equal distance from previous prime (758578987) and next prime (758578993).

It is a congruent number.

It is not an unprimeable number, because it can be changed into a prime (758578993) by changing a digit.

It is a polite number, since it can be written in 31 ways as a sum of consecutive naturals, for example, 71617 + ... + 81523.

It is an arithmetic number, because the mean of its divisors is an integer number (24968160).

Almost surely, 2758578990 is an apocalyptic number.

758578990 is an abundant number, since it is smaller than the sum of its proper divisors (839383250).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

758578990 is a wasteful number, since it uses less digits than its factorization.

758578990 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 9977.

The product of its (nonzero) digits is 6350400, while the sum is 58.

The square root of 758578990 is about 27542.3127206123. The cubic root of 758578990 is about 912.0114064119.

The spelling of 758578990 in words is "seven hundred fifty-eight million, five hundred seventy-eight thousand, nine hundred ninety".

Divisors: 1 2 5 10 13 19 26 31 38 62 65 95 130 155 190 247 310 403 494 589 806 1178 1235 2015 2470 2945 4030 5890 7657 9907 15314 19814 38285 49535 76570 99070 128791 188233 257582 307117 376466 614234 643955 941165 1287910 1535585 1882330 2447029 3071170 3992521 4894058 5835223 7985042 11670446 12235145 19962605 24470290 29176115 39925210 58352230 75857899 151715798 379289495 758578990